Configuring Static Subscriber Interfaces in Dynamic Profiles
In this release, you can use dynamic profiles to configure statically created logical interfaces. Dynamic profiles enable you to dynamically apply configured values (including CoS, IGMP, or filter configuration) to the static interfaces, making them easier to manage.
To configure static interfaces, you must first configure the interfaces on the router to which you expect subscribers to connect.
The subscriber access feature supports the following statically-created interface types in dynamic profiles:
- GE—Gigabit Ethernet
- XE—10 Gigabit Ethernet
- AE—Aggregated Ethernet

Configuring a Subscriber Interface with a Static VLAN Interface
This topic describes how to configure a subscriber interface with a static VLAN interface.
After you configure the static VLAN interface, you can reference it in a dynamic profile.
To configure a subscriber interface over a VLAN:
- Configure the static VLAN interface and enable
VLAN tagging.[edit interfaces]ge-5/0/0 {vlan-tagging;}
- Configure the units and assign the VLAN
IDs.unit 1 {proxy-arp;vlan-id 1;family inet {unnumbered-address lo0.0 preferred-source-address 192.1.1.1;}}unit 2 {proxy-arp;vlan-id 2;family inet {unnumbered-address lo0.0 preferred-source-address 192.1.1.1;}}
- Associate the static subscriber interface
in a dynamic profile.
See Associating Dynamic Profiles with Statically Created Interfaces.
Configuring Static Subscriber Interfaces Using IP Demux Interfaces
You can configure a subscriber interface using a statically created IP demux interface. This interface can be referenced in a dynamic profile.
To configure a static IP demux subscriber interface:
- Configure the IP demux interface on a physical device represented by a logical unit number. The logical interface resides on a physical device.
- Configure the underlying interface on which the IP demux interface is running.
- Specify the underlying interface on which the IP demux interface is running.
- Specify how ingress IPv4 traffic is to be demultiplexed based on packet destination or source addresses.
- Associate the static subscriber interface in a
dynamic profile.
See Associating Dynamic Profiles with Statically Created Interfaces.
![]() | Note: VLAN demux interfaces currently support the Internet Protocol version 4 (IPv4) suite (family inet) and the Internet Protocol version 6 (IPv6) suite (family inet6). |
Configuring Static Subscriber Interfaces Using VLAN Demux Interfaces
You can configure a subscriber interface using a statically created VLAN demux interface. This interface can be referenced in a dynamic profile.
To configure a static VLAN demux subscriber interface:
- Configure the VLAN demux interface.
- Configure the underlying interface on which the VLAN demux interface is running.
- Specify the underlying interface on which the VLAN demux interface is running.
- Specify how ingress IP traffic is to be demultiplexed based on the VLAN ID.
- Associate the static subscriber interface in a
dynamic profile.
See Associating Dynamic Profiles with Statically Created Interfaces.
![]() | Note: VLAN demux interfaces currently support the Internet Protocol version 4 (IPv4) suite (family inet) and the Internet Protocol version 6 (IPv6) suite (family inet6). |
Associating Dynamic Profiles with Statically Created Interfaces
When configuring the interfaces stanza within a dynamic profile, you use variables to specify the interface name and the logical unit value. When a DHCP subscriber sends a DHCP request to the interface, the dynamic profile replaces the interface name variable and logical unit name variable with the actual interface name and logical unit number of the interface that received the DHCP request.
![]() | Note: Configuration of the interface name variable and logical interface name variable at the [edit dynamic-profiles profile-name interfaces] hierarchy level is required for a dynamic profile to function. |
To configure the interface for a dynamic profile, specify the interface name variable and include the unit statement and associated logical interface name variable:
- Access the profile.[edit]user@host# edit dynamic-profiles basic-profile
- Specify the interface name variable.[edit dynamic-profiles basic-profile]user@host# set interfaces $junos-interface-ifd-name
- Specify the logical interface name variable
with the unit statement.
When referencing an existing interface, specify the $junos-underlying-interface-unit variable used by the router to match the unit value of the receiving interface:
[edit dynamic-profiles basic-profile]user@host# set unit $junos-underlying-interface-unitWhen creating dynamic interfaces, specify the $junos-interface-unit variable used by the router to generate a unit value for the interface:
[edit dynamic-profiles basic-profile]user@host# set unit $junos-interface-unit
